I just learned of googles awesome ability that allows you use the chrome developer console on your pc, with your android device using chrome through USB Debugging.

Now Google has a step by step guide to get it to work, but I am unsuccessful every time. I can never get the chrome browser to find my device that is connected.

I do have the USB Debugging enabled in the developer options, and the phone is connected to my pc. Has anyone used this before that may know what I am missing?

Thank you
 
I was able to solve the problem. The problem was the Samsung usb driver on the computer. For what ever reason I had to uninstall the samsung driver and substitute it for a "universal" adb driver. Once I did this, it worked.

After using the remote debugger for a little while now, I must say that it is a pretty amazing tool to have for mobile site development. Definitely something worth checking out. Not only can you use the developer console on your pc, but you can access localhost sites via port forwarding. Very useful tool, one more reason I am a happy android user.
